Smooth move for Thornton & Ross in nappy rash deal

12th January 2010

Share:

THORNTON & Ross, the Yorkshire-based group which is the largest independent pharmaceutical group in the UK, has paid £2.2m for a nappy rash treatment brand.

The family-owned Huddersfield firm has bought the Metanium brand from Ransom.

The Metanium brand is made up of two ointment products - Metanium nappy rash ointment and Metanium cradle cap cream.
